Last night began our Sleep Training for Benjamin. He's 12wks old today!! WOW! Time flies. He's getting so big.
Anyhow, he generally wakes up only 1 time in the middle of the night, somewhere between 3am-4am. For the past couple of weeks, he hasn't really needed to eat at this time. He's waking up more out of habit than any real need.
Well, now that he is 12wks old, it's time to help him adjust his internal clock and sleep through the night. He goes down for bed at 7pm and gets his final feeding by 11pm. He can definitely stretch through the night, he simply needs a little help.
By this age, Aubrey had already been sleeping solid through the night so this is a new task for us in the parenting arena.
Since Rudy had to work I took night one of going in to comfort him when he woke up. This wasn't the most ideal situation since when he sees/smells me he would assume he would be fed which would not be the case. Anyhow, around 2:20am (slightly earlier than usual) he wakes up. I go in, give him his pacifier and change his diaper. I lay him back in bed and he continues to cry/fuss for the next hour! UGH! However, by 3:20am he was sound asleep again. So I proceed back to our bed and crash myself (thankfully). I was hoping that would be it for the night- No Dice! He woke up again at 4:20am. I went in, made sure he was okay, gave him his pacifier and he was out within 10 minutes. That is much better than the hour I had spent in his room earlier. He then stayed asleep until just before 7am which is his normal wake-time!
Overall, I would say that was a victory for us on a couple different sleeping fronts. 1- It was brutal to be awake that long but he was able to sooth himself back to sleep! 2- Aubrey stayed sound asleep the entire time he cried! I was super impressed!
